Austria - Import of Parts and Accessories of Machine Tools (Including Machines for Nailing, Stapling, Glueing or Otherwise Assembling) for Working Wood, Cork, Bone, Hard Rubber, Hard Plastics or Similar Hard Materials

Since 2014, Austria Import of Parts and Accessories of Machine Tools (Including Machines for Nailing, Stapling, Glueing or Otherwise Assembling) for Working Wood, Cork, Bone, Hard Rubber, Hard Plastics or Similar Hard Materials was up 5.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 2 comparing other countries in Import of Parts and Accessories of Machine Tools (Including Machines for Nailing, Stapling, Glueing or Otherwise Assembling) for Working Wood, Cork, Bone, Hard Rubber, Hard Plastics or Similar Hard Materials at €86,799,729.87. Germany lead the ranking with €161,856,912.64 in 2019, that is a growth of 5.5% compared to 2018. Latvia witnessed the best average annual growth at +16% per year, while France was the worst growing country at -0.4% per year.
